What Is a Ladder Jack and How Does It Work?

A ladder jack is a scaffolding device that allows workers to safely and efficiently use ladders to support planks for various tasks, such as painting, siding, or roof work. It is typically made of metal or heavy-duty plastic and can accommodate various ladder types, providing a stable platform for multiple workers or tools.

According to the Occupational Safety and Health Administration (OSHA), a ladder jack is recognized as a safe alternative to traditional scaffolding methods, as it offers additional stability and support, reducing the risk of falls and injuries on the job site.

Key aspects of a ladder jack include its design, which features brackets that attach to the sides of a ladder, allowing for the insertion of planks horizontally across two ladders. This arrangement creates a work surface that is elevated and easily accessible. The ladder jack is often adjustable, accommodating different ladder heights and widths, which enhances its versatility. Additionally, the setup is relatively quick, enabling workers to assemble and disassemble the scaffold as needed without extensive downtime.

This tool significantly impacts the construction and maintenance industries by improving worker safety and efficiency. With proper use, a ladder jack can support a load of approximately 500 pounds, making it suitable for various tasks. Statistics indicate that falls account for a significant percentage of workplace injuries, and using ladder jacks can help mitigate these risks by providing a more secure working environment. According to the National Safety Council, falls from heights are among the leading causes of fatalities in the construction industry.

The benefits of using a ladder jack include increased productivity, as workers can complete tasks more quickly and with less physical strain. Moreover, ladder jacks can be employed in both residential and commercial projects, making them a versatile solution for contractors and DIY enthusiasts alike. They also promote better ergonomics, reducing the likelihood of musculoskeletal injuries associated with repetitive lifting or awkward postures.

Best practices for using ladder jacks involve ensuring that the ladders are placed on stable, level ground and that they are properly secured before use. Users should also inspect the ladder jack and ladders for any damage prior to setup. Furthermore, it’s essential to adhere to weight limits and to avoid overreaching while on the platform to maintain balance and stability. Proper training on how to safely use ladder jacks can further enhance safety and effectiveness on the job site.

Why Should You Use a Ladder Jack for Your Projects?

The underlying mechanism of a ladder jack’s effectiveness lies in its design, which typically includes braces and supports that distribute weight evenly across the ladder and the surface it is mounted on. This distribution minimizes the likelihood of tipping or shifting, which can occur with traditional ladder setups. Furthermore, the ladder jack allows for the attachment of planks, creating a wider work surface that can accommodate tools and materials, decreasing the need for frequent ladder adjustments and thus reducing the risk of falls.

Additionally, using a ladder jack can lead to increased productivity. When workers feel secure and have adequate space to maneuver tools and materials, they can complete their tasks more efficiently. Research shows that improved safety measures not only protect workers but also lead to better job performance, as employees are less distracted by safety concerns (National Institute for Occupational Safety and Health, 2020). This combination of safety and efficiency makes ladder jacks an essential tool for any project involving elevated work.

What Factors Should You Consider When Selecting a Ladder Jack?

When selecting the best ladder jack, several factors should be considered to ensure safety, efficiency, and suitability for your needs.

  • Load Capacity: It’s essential to choose a ladder jack that can safely support the weight of the materials and tools you’ll be using. Different models have varying load capacities, so ensure the ladder jack you select can handle the maximum weight required for your tasks.
  • Material Quality: The materials used in the construction of the ladder jack significantly affect its durability and strength. Look for ladder jacks made from high-quality materials such as aluminum or heavy-duty steel, which can withstand the rigors of frequent use and adverse weather conditions.
  • Height Adjustability: A good ladder jack should offer height adjustability to accommodate different working heights and angles. This feature allows for greater versatility and ensures that you can reach your desired work area safely without compromising stability.
  • Stability Features: Stability is crucial when using a ladder jack, so consider models that come with additional stability features like anti-slip pads or wider bases. These features help reduce the risk of tipping and enhance safety while working at heights.
  • Ease of Setup: Select a ladder jack that is easy to assemble and disassemble, as this can save you time and effort during projects. User-friendly designs often include easy-to-follow instructions and require minimal tools for setup.
  • Compatibility with Ladders: Ensure that the ladder jack you select is compatible with the type of ladder you have. Some ladder jacks are designed specifically for certain ladder types, so verifying compatibility is essential for safe and effective use.
  • Portability: If you need to move the ladder jack frequently, consider its weight and portability features. Lightweight designs or those that fold compactly can make transportation and storage easier.
  • Price: While not always an indicator of quality, price is an important factor to consider when selecting a ladder jack. Set a budget but also weigh the cost against features and safety ratings to ensure you’re getting a good value for your investment.

What Materials Affect the Durability and Safety of a Ladder Jack?

The durability and safety of a ladder jack are influenced by several key materials used in its construction:

  • Aluminum: Aluminum is commonly used in ladder jacks due to its lightweight nature and resistance to rust and corrosion. This material allows for easy portability while maintaining structural integrity, making it suitable for both indoor and outdoor use.
  • Steel: Steel ladder jacks offer increased strength and stability compared to aluminum, making them ideal for heavy-duty applications. However, they are heavier and may require additional care to prevent rusting, particularly when used in damp or outdoor environments.
  • Plastic composites: Some ladder jacks incorporate plastic composites, which can provide a balance of durability and lightweight characteristics. These materials are often resistant to weathering and can be designed to be impact-resistant, adding to the overall safety of the ladder jack.
  • Non-slip coatings: The use of non-slip coatings on ladder jacks enhances safety by providing better grip on ladders and surfaces. This material helps prevent slips and falls, which are common hazards when working at heights.
  • Rubber feet: Ladder jacks often feature rubber feet that improve traction and stability when placed on surfaces. These rubber components help absorb shock and prevent sliding, contributing significantly to the overall safety of the ladder jack while in use.

How Should You Properly Use a Ladder Jack for Maximum Safety and Efficiency?

To properly use a ladder jack for maximum safety and efficiency, several key practices and considerations should be followed:

  • Choose the Right Ladder Jack: Selecting a ladder jack that is rated for your specific ladder type and work requirements is crucial. Ensure it is designed to hold the weight of the materials and the user safely.
  • Inspect Before Use: Always perform a thorough inspection of the ladder jack before each use. Check for any signs of wear, damage, or malfunction, as these could compromise safety during operation.
  • Securely Attach the Ladder Jack: Properly attach the ladder jack to the ladder rungs according to the manufacturer’s instructions. Ensure that it is firmly in place and that the ladder is on stable, level ground to prevent slipping.
  • Use Proper Safety Gear: Wearing appropriate safety gear, such as a hard hat and non-slip footwear, is essential when working at heights. This gear protects against potential falls or falling objects while using the ladder jack.
  • Maintain Three Points of Contact: When climbing or working from a ladder jack, always maintain three points of contact with the ladder. This means at least two hands and one foot, or two feet and one hand, should be in contact with the ladder at all times for stability.
  • Limit Workload on the Ladder Jack: Be mindful of the weight limit specified by the manufacturer. Overloading the ladder jack can lead to instability or failure, increasing the risk of accidents.
  • Follow Safe Work Practices: Maintain awareness of your surroundings while using a ladder jack. Avoid distractions and ensure that the work area below is clear of hazards to prevent accidents or injuries.
  • Use a Spotter: If possible, have a spotter present while using a ladder jack. A spotter can help stabilize the ladder and provide assistance in case of an emergency, enhancing overall safety.
